Senior Propulsion Technician (R4638)
Full Time Employee 28 - 42 USD per-hour-wageJob Overview
We are seeking a highly skilled Propulsion Technician to join our X-BAT Propulsion Engineering team, specializing in UAV propulsion systems. In this role, you will be responsible for the assembly, testing, troubleshooting, and maintenance of low-bypass turbofan engines in both test cell environments and pre/post-flight operations. Our team owns the engine from start to finish, requiring technicians with a high level of expertise, attention to detail, and a strong problem-solving mindset.
We are particularly looking for candidates with an A&P license, prior experience working with aircraft engines, and a background in aerospace companies or military aviation maintenance. What you will do in this role:
- Conduct engine assembly, disassembly, and integration for UAV propulsion systems.
- Perform pre-flight and post-flight inspections, ensuring all propulsion systems meet operational standards.
- Operate test cells for engine validation, tuning, and troubleshooting.
- Diagnose and resolve mechanical, electrical, and performance issues related to propulsion systems.
- Work closely with engineers and flight test teams to ensure system readiness.
- Maintain detailed records of maintenance activities, inspections, and modifications.
- Follow strict safety protocols and standard operating procedures in handling high-performance UAV propulsion systems.
Required qualifications:
- Minimum 3-5 years of experience working on aircraft engines (military or civilian).
- Prior experience at an aerospace company or military aviation unit.
- Strong troubleshooting skills with gas turbine, reciprocating, or hybrid propulsion systems.
- Ability to interpret technical manuals, schematics, and engineering documents.
- Comfortable working in high-energy, high-precision environments.
- Strong safety mindset, with meticulous attention to detail.
- U.S. Citizenship or ability to comply with ITAR requirements.
Preferred qualifications:
- Airframe & Powerplant (A&P) License.
- Military background, particularly in jet propulsion, UAVs, or rotary-wing aircraft.
- Experience with unmanned aerial vehicle (UAV) propulsion.
- Knowledge of fuel systems, ignition systems, and advanced propulsion technologies.
- Hands-on experience with engine dynamometers, test cells, or ground support equipment.
- FAA Powerplant or military equivalent engine qualifications.
- Ability to work independently, taking ownership of full-cycle propulsion system maintenance.
